WATCH: Latifi brings out red flags at Red Bull Ring after first crash of 2020 in FP3
Nichola Latifi brought out the red flags at the Red Bull Ring on Saturday after the Williams driver registered the first crash of the 2020 season.
The Canadian rookie was busy running through his programme in the third free practice session ahead of Saturday afternoon's qualifying session for the Austrian Grand Prix – his first race in F1 – when he hit the kerbs on the exit of Turn 1 and slammed into the barriers, ripping off his front wing in the process – as you can see in the video above.
The race director immediately threw the red flag to pause the session while the Williams FW43 car was recovered to the pit lane. After assessing the damage, Williams expect the Canadian's machine to be fine for qualifying, with the car needing new front and rear wings but no major work.
